Understanding the DOES Acronym: A Framework for Highly Sensitive Person (HSP) Traits

High sensitivity, formally known as Sensory Processing Sensitivity (SPS), is an innate personality trait found in approximately 15-20% of the population. First identified by Dr. Elaine Aron in the 1990s, this trait is characterized by a deeper processing of sensory and emotional information, leading to heightened awareness of both internal and external environments. While often described in popular discourse, the scientific community recognizes high sensitivity as a biological trait present in over 100 animal species, including fruit flies that exhibit distinct behavioral patterns as “sitters” and “rovers.” Dr. Aron’s seminal work, The Highly Sensitive Person: How to Thrive When the World Overwhelms You, established a foundational understanding of this trait, emphasizing that high sensitivity is not an illness or flaw but a form of neurodiversity. To help individuals and clinicians understand the core characteristics of this trait, Dr. Aron developed the DOES acronym, which outlines four key pillars: Depth of Processing, Overstimulation, Emotional Reactivity/Empathy, and Sensory Sensitivity. This framework provides a structured way to recognize and navigate the experiences of Highly Sensitive Persons (HSPs), offering insights into their unique strengths and challenges within the context of mental health and well-being.

The DOES Acronym: Core Characteristics of High Sensitivity

The DOES acronym serves as a comprehensive model for identifying and understanding the primary attributes associated with high sensitivity. Each component represents a distinct aspect of the HSP experience, collectively shaping how individuals perceive, process, and interact with the world. Research and clinical observations indicate that these traits are not isolated but interrelated, often amplifying one another in daily life. For instance, the Depth of Processing trait may lead to more profound emotional reactions, which can, in turn, increase susceptibility to overstimulation in chaotic environments. D – Depth of Processing

Depth of Processing refers to the tendency of Highly Sensitive Persons to engage in more thorough and reflective information processing compared to the general population. This trait involves a biological predisposition to analyze sensory input, experiences, and decisions with greater nuance and consideration. HSPs often exhibit a rich inner life, characterized by extensive introspection, questioning of big ideas, and thoughtful evaluation of consequences. For example, when planning a camping trip, an HSP might conduct detailed research on potential locations, create comprehensive checklists for household organization, and consider multiple criteria to ensure the trip meets their standards. This depth is not synonymous with overthinking or anxiety but rather reflects a neurological wiring that notices more details and makes more connections between pieces of information. In clinical terms, this trait can contribute to strengths such as conscientiousness, creativity, and the ability to identify subtle patterns that others may miss. However, it may also lead to challenges like analysis paralysis, where the extensive processing of options delays decision-making. Mental health professionals often note that this trait is a double-edged sword: it fosters wisdom and intentionality but requires strategies to manage the cognitive load associated with thorough processing. In therapeutic settings, recognizing depth of processing can help clients understand why they may need more time for reflection and how to harness this trait for improved emotional regulation and problem-solving.

O – Overstimulation

Overstimulation is a core challenge for many HSPs, arising from their heightened awareness of sensory and emotional stimuli. This trait describes the ease with which HSPs become overwhelmed by environments or situations that involve excessive noise, chaos, strong smells, bright lights, or social complexity. For instance, a bustling café with multiple conversations, background music, and strong aromas may trigger sensory overload, leading to agitation or withdrawal. Similarly, full days at a mall followed by a loud party, large social groups, or unstructured classrooms can be particularly taxing. Overstimulation is often the most noticeable trait to others and can manifest as a need for solitude, avoidance of plans, or turning down invitations to conserve energy. In psychological terms, this reflects a more reactive autonomic nervous system, where the body’s stress response is activated more readily in high-stimulus settings. Clinically, this is not a sign of fragility but a natural consequence of processing more information from the environment. Effective management strategies, such as seeking quiet spaces, setting boundaries, and scheduling downtime, are frequently recommended in mental health contexts to prevent chronic stress and burnout. Overstimulation can also be confused with other conditions, such as anxiety disorders, but its root in sensory processing sensitivity distinguishes it as a trait-specific experience. Understanding this component of the DOES acronym is crucial for developing personalized coping mechanisms that align with an HSP’s neurological profile.

E – Emotional Reactivity/Empathy

Emotional Reactivity and Empathy represent the capacity of HSPs to experience emotions with greater intensity and depth, both positively and negatively. This trait involves heightened sensitivity to emotional cues in oneself and others, often leading to strong empathic responses. HSPs may feel joy, sadness, fear, or compassion more profoundly than less sensitive individuals, which can enrich their relationships and creative expressions. For example, they might be deeply moved by art, nature, or human stories, or they may absorb the emotions of those around them, leading to a strong sense of empathy. However, this intensity can also make them more vulnerable to emotional exhaustion, particularly in environments where others’ distress is palpable. In clinical observations, this trait is linked to a greater activation of brain regions associated with emotion and empathy, such as the insula and anterior cingulate cortex. While this can be a strength in therapeutic or caregiving roles, it may contribute to emotional overwhelm if not balanced with self-regulation techniques. Mental health professionals emphasize that emotional reactivity is not a deficit but a feature of the HSP trait, requiring validation and skill-building to navigate. Strategies such as mindfulness, emotional labeling, and boundary-setting can help HSPs manage their emotional responses without suppressing them. In the context of holistic well-being, acknowledging emotional reactivity as part of the DOES framework supports a non-pathologizing approach to mental health, aligning with trauma-informed care principles that prioritize individual differences and strengths.

S – Sensory Sensitivity

Sensory Sensitivity is the final component of the DOES acronym, describing the heightened awareness of subtle stimuli in the environment. This trait involves noticing textures, tastes, smells, sounds, and visual details that others may barely register. For example, an HSP might be acutely aware of the texture of clothing, the flavor nuances in food, or the faint scent of a flower, which can enhance appreciation for beauty and subtlety. However, this sensitivity can also lead to discomfort or overwhelm when stimuli are intense or prolonged, such as in loud concerts, crowded spaces, or environments with harsh lighting. In neurological terms, sensory sensitivity is associated with a more efficient processing of sensory information in the brain, particularly in areas like the somatosensory cortex. This trait is closely related to overstimulation, as the accumulation of sensory input can quickly exceed an HSP’s capacity to process it. From a mental health perspective, sensory sensitivity can influence daily functioning, affecting choices in living spaces, work environments, and social activities. Clinicians often work with HSPs to identify sensory triggers and develop adaptive strategies, such as using noise-canceling headphones, choosing calming environments, or practicing sensory grounding techniques. Recognizing sensory sensitivity as a core trait helps destigmatize the experience and encourages the use of tailored interventions that respect individual neurodiversity. Clinical Implications and Therapeutic Considerations

While the DOES acronym provides a descriptive framework for high sensitivity, its application in mental health contexts requires careful consideration of individual differences and evidence-based practices. High sensitivity is not a disorder but a trait, and as such, it does not require treatment unless it contributes to significant distress or impairment. However, many HSPs seek support for challenges like anxiety, stress, or emotional overwhelm, which can be exacerbated by the trait’s characteristics. In therapeutic settings, clinicians may use the DOES model to help clients understand their experiences, reduce self-stigma, and develop coping strategies. For instance, depth of processing can be leveraged in cognitive-behavioral therapy to encourage reflective thinking, while overstimulation and sensory sensitivity may inform environmental modifications or relaxation techniques. Emotional reactivity and empathy can be addressed through emotion-focused therapy or mindfulness-based interventions to enhance regulation. Conclusion

The DOES acronym, developed by Dr. Elaine Aron, offers a valuable framework for understanding the core traits of High Sensitivity, including Depth of Processing, Overstimulation, Emotional Reactivity/Empathy, and Sensory Sensitivity. This model highlights the biological basis of high sensitivity, which affects 15-20% of the population and is observed across species, and emphasizes its role as a form of neurodiversity rather than a disorder. In mental health contexts, recognizing these traits can help individuals navigate challenges like overstimulation and emotional intensity while harnessing strengths such as creativity, empathy, and depth of thought. Therapeutic approaches should be individualized, focusing on validation, coping strategies, and environmental adjustments to support well-being.
